About the Role
As a Senior Data Analyst at Wolters Kluwer, you will engage in comprehensive data analysis, contribute to key projects and drive actionable insights. You will work with diverse datasets and use advanced statistical techniques to support predictive modeling and business optimization efforts.
Responsibilities
- Monitor key financial KPIs such as revenue and transaction volumes.
- Consolidate data from invoicing databases, Salesforce, and Arrow.
- Segment metrics by customer attributes to identify trends.
- Provide insights for strategic planning and performance reviews.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ment.
- Analyze data to discover growth opportunities and solve business challenges.
- Develop models to identify trends and test hypotheses.
- Refine business models and build data-backed business cases.
- Streamline and automate reports and dashboards.
- Promote a data-driven culture across the organization.
- Mentor junior data scientists and share your expertise.
Skills and Tools
- Proficiency in data visualization and business intelligence tools like Tableau and Power BI.
- Strong programming skills in Python using libraries such as NumPy, Pandas, and Matplotlib.
- Experience automating data workflows with Python, Excel automation using openpyxl, and custom scripts.
- Familiarity with Excel macros and VBA for enhancing reporting efficiency.
- Advanced Excel functions including pivot tables, lookups and dynamic formulas.
- Strong SQL capabilities for data manipulation, reporting, and query optimization.
- Ability to understand business workflows and propose efficient alternatives.
Company Culture and Benefits
Wolters Kluwer is a dynamic global technology company that values diversity, inclusivity, and employee well-being. With a legacy spanning 188 years, the company reported 2023 revenues of €5.6 billion and serves customers in over 180 countries. Here, you can thrive in a supportive environment that values your unique contributions, offers career growth, and provides well-being programs designed to keep you healthy, happy, and safe.
